A gas takes up a volume of 35 L, and has a pressure of 4.8 atm. What is the new pressure of
the gas if the volume decreases to 23 L?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 23-04-2020

Answer:

7.3 atm

Explanation:

- Use the formula P1V1 = P2V2

- Rearrange formula and then plug in values.
